§ 1727.01 — Farm laborers' association - holding of real estate

Text
No association incorporated for the purpose of promoting the interests of agriculture, for the relief of distressed farm laborers or their widows and orphans, whether such widows and orphans are members of the association or not, and for any other charitable purpose, shall take or hold real estate, except such as is actually occupied in the exercise of its legitimate business, or as it acquires in security for or satisfaction of debts due it. Real estate so occupied shall not in any case exceed fifty thousand dollars in value.

Legislative History
Effective: October 1, 1953 | Latest Legislation: House Bill 1 - 100th General Assembly
